Output 2bbda01901c8af65551d021eaadb5014edb9983e3bdde250c153700118766415:2

value
18400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5dd66fe722763aae1cae0b4d800523b9f880d81c OP_EQUALVERIFY OP_CHECKSIG
address
19ZAjCAooPSafRq9CMjgy57Eogb6npqEri
transaction
2bbda01901c8af65551d021eaadb5014edb9983e3bdde250c153700118766415
spent
true